Installation & Safety Advice

This 90 Degree Elbow with Access Door should only be used as a connecting pipe and must not pass through ceilings or walls—use twin wall insulated flue pipe for such installations. For safety, ensure the single wall stove pipe is installed at least three times its diameter away from combustible materials such as wood or plasterboard.

Install with the smaller diameter pointing downward to keep condensates inside the flue system. All joints should be sealed with a fire cement or high-temperature silicone sealant to prevent leaks and maintain the appearance of your flue system.

Maintenance

Regular inspection and cleaning of your flue system are vital for safe operation, especially with solid fuel appliances. The access door on this 90 Degree Elbow makes maintenance straightforward. For best practice, chimneys should be swept at least once a year, or more frequently depending on usage.
